Как спроектированы серверные операционные системы
Серверные операционные системы составляют собой специализированное программное обеспечение для регулирования аппаратурными средствами компьютера. Организация таких систем выстраивается на основе многозадачности и многопользовательского доступа. Ядро координирует работу процессора, операционной памяти, дисковых носителей и сетевых интерфейсов.
Базу образует модульная организация, где каждый элемент исполняет конкретные функции. Драйверы обеспечивают взаимодействие с материальным аппаратурой. Планировщик задач выделяет вычислительные мощности между процессами. Файловая система структурирует размещение данных на хранилищах.
Серверная вавада объединяет модули для обслуживания сетевых запросов и активации приложений. Системные библиотеки предоставляют процессам встроенные функции для взаимодействия с средствами. Системы разделения процессов исключают коллизии между программами.
Интерфейс командной строки позволяет управляющим конфигурировать установки и мониторить положение системы. Логи событий записывают информацию о функционировании компонентов vavada casino. Такая структура обеспечивает бесперебойную функционирование устройств под большой загрузкой.
Чем серверная ОС разнится от обычной
Принципиальное расхождение кроется в цели и варианте эксплуатации. Десктопные системы нацелены на деятельность одного юзера с графическими приложениями. Серверные платформы обрабатывают множество одновременных сессий и исполняют фоновые операции без участия человека.
Графический интерфейс в серверных вариантах нередко отсутствует или упрощен. Управление осуществляется через командную строку и конфигурационные документы. Такой подход уменьшает использование возможностей и поднимает скорость. Десктопные редакции обеспечивают оконные утилиты для ежедневных операций.
Серверные решения предоставляют улучшенные опции расширения. Системы vavada работают с крупными объемами памяти и набором процессорных cores. Устойчивость и бесперебойность деятельности критически значимы для серверного программного обеспечения. Системы конструируются для беспрерывного работы без перезагрузок. Системы дублирования защищают от неполадок. Десктопные редакции позволяют систематические перезагрузки и менее чувствительны к устойчивости.
Основополагающие задачи серверных систем
Серверные системы реализуют совокупность функций по гарантированию работы сетевых служб и программ:
- Осуществление входящих сетевых подключений и маршрутизация данных.
- Запуск и контроль работы пользовательских программ и веб-сервисов.
- Деление процессорной ресурсов между работающими задачами.
- Мониторинг состояния технических узлов и софтверных модулей.
- Создание журналов событий для изучения эффективности.
Программное обеспечение согласует взаимодействие между клиентными аппаратами и процессорными возможностями. Конструкция позволяет синхронно обрабатывать тысячи запросов от различных операторов.
Размещение и контроль данными образует центральную цель серверных решений. Файловые накопители обеспечивают обращение к файлам, медиафайлам и бэкапам. Системы управления базами данных обрабатывают систематизированную сведения. Средства архивного дублирования предохраняют ценные сведения от потери.
Решение предоставляет сегрегацию клиентских сред и программ. Виртуализация обеспечивает стартовать множество независимых казино вавада на одном реальном хосте. Балансировка загрузки делит задачи между доступными средствами для эффективной производительности.
Как выполняются запросы пользователей
Процесс выполнения стартует с приема запроса через сетевой интерфейс. Приходящее соединение направляется в очередь, где дожидается своей хода. Сетевой слой анализирует блоки данных и выявляет нужный службу. Планировщик передает запрос релевантному программному элементу.
Программа принимает информацию и производит необходимые действия. Приложение может подключиться к файловой системе для считывания или записи сведений. База данных выдает затребованные элементы. Вычислительные действия производятся процессором согласно важности операции.
Многопоточная конструкция дает выполнять совокупность обращений одновременно. Каждое коннект приобретает собственный поток исполнения. Планировщик делит CPU время между выполняющимися процессами. Серверная вавада проверяет потребление памяти и пресекает исчерпание возможностей.
Сформированный ответ направляется обратно пользователю через сетевое подключение. Протоколы транспортного уровня гарантируют доставку сведений. Журнал сохраняет информацию о совершенной действии и статусе выполнения. Освобожденные ресурсы делаются готовыми для последующих обращений.
Контроль возможностями и загрузкой
Оптимальное разделение возможностей гарантирует надежную деятельность всех служб. Координатор операций выявляет приоритеты процессов и назначает процессорное время. Методы распределения блокируют переполнение конкретных компонентов. Отслеживание отслеживает текущее положение аппаратуры в настоящем времени.
Оперативная память распределяется между выполняющимися программами адаптивно. Механизм виртуализации эксплуатирует дисковое пространство при дефиците аппаратной памяти. Кэширование повышает обращение к часто запрашиваемым сведениям. Самостоятельная уборка освобождает неиспользуемые области памяти.
Дисковые действия улучшаются через очереди запросов и предварительное считывание. Файловая система кластеризует смежные данные для уменьшения времени обращения. Серверные vavada обеспечивают оперативную замену дисков без прекращения функционирования.
Сетевая компонент отслеживает передающую способность магистралей передачи. Ограничение скорости предотвращает монополизацию bandwidth индивидуальными каналами. Классификация потока обеспечивает качество предоставления важных модулей. Аналитика нагруженности содействует проектировать расширение системы.
Безопасность и контроль входа
Обеспечение сведений и средств основывается на иерархической модели деления прав. Каждый оператор получает индивидуальный ID и совокупность привилегий. Аутентификация удостоверяет достоверность регистрационных записей при входе. Пароли хранятся в криптованном формате для блокирования неавторизованного проникновения.
Полномочия доступа к данным и каталогам настраиваются отдельно для каждого ресурса. Владелец элемента устанавливает допустимые процедуры для иных клиентов. Объединения объединяют регистрационные записи с одинаковыми правами. Серверная казино вавада пресекает попытки осуществления недопустимых действий.
Межсетевой брандмауэр проверяет входящий и выходной трафик по определенным критериям. Списки контроля сужают подключения с определенных IP-адресов. Системы детектирования атак анализируют подозрительную активность. Шифрование предохраняет транспортируемую сведения от перехвата.
Протоколы безопасности регистрируют все попытки подключения к закрытым объектам. Анализ событий содействует определить отступления стандартов. Автоматизированные уведомления информируют операторов о серьезных инцидентах. Регулярное актуализация правил адаптирует решение к актуальным опасностям.
Работа с сетью и подключениями
Сетевая подсистема гарантирует коммуникацию сервера с внешними машинами и иными серверами. Сетевые интерфейсы получают и передают информацию по различным стандартам. Драйверы карт управляют аппаратными портами. Настройка IP-адресов определяет распознавание узла в сети.
Стек протоколов TCP/IP обрабатывает транспортировку сведений на разных слоях. Перенаправление направляет фрагменты к назначенным точкам через оптимальные трассы. DNS-резолвер преобразует доменные обозначения в числовые адреса. DHCP самостоятельно распределяет сетевые параметры присоединенным машинам.
Администрирование подключениями объединяет контроль открытых сессий и таймаутов. Наборы подключений многократно используют активные линии для сохранения средств. Серверные вавада поддерживают тысячи параллельных TCP-соединений через эффективным алгоритмам. Балансеры разносят приходящий данные между разными машинами.
Мониторинг сетевой активности проверяет передающую способность и латентность. Тестовые средства верифицируют связность дистанционных хостов. Данные адаптеров демонстрирует величины переданных информации и объем ошибок. Настройка очередей улучшает производительность при множественных типах загрузки.
Обновления и поддержание платформы
Систематическое апдейт программного обеспечения предоставляет безопасность и надежность деятельности. Создатели выпускают фиксы для устранения уязвимостей и багов. Менеджеры пакетов упрощают получение и развертывание обновлений. Управляющие организуют внедрение изменений в моменты наименьшей нагрузки.
Проверка апдейтов на отдельных площадках предотвращает непредвиденные сбои. Архивное сохранение параметров дает оперативно откатить изменения при сбоях. Серверная vavada обеспечивает функции восстановления к старым редакциям компонентов.
Мониторинг состояния проверяет присутствие актуальных версий утилит и библиотек. Уведомления оповещают о приоритетных апдейтах защиты. Самостоятельные сканирования выявляют неактуальные блоки. Регламенты актуализации назначают первоочередности и периоды применения изменений.
Техническая поддержка производителей предлагает советы по настройке и решению проблем. Коммьюнити пользователей делится опытом реализации задач. Репозитории информации содержат инструкции по настройке. Коммерческие договоры гарантируют доступ патчей в продолжение установленного срока.
Где используются серверные операционные системы
Веб-хостинг составляет одну из основных направлений эксплуатации серверных платформ. Компании располагают сайты и веб-приложения на физических или виртуальных машинах. Системы выполняют HTTP-запросы от миллионов юзеров каждодневно.
Корпоративные сети базируются на серверную инфраструктуру для размещения данных и запуска бизнес-приложений. Файловые серверы обеспечивают консолидированный подключение к материалам. Почтовые решения выполняют переписку организации. Базы данных содержат информацию о заказчиках и денежных транзакциях.
Облачные провайдеры выстраивают расширяемые платформы на основе серверных систем. Виртуализация обеспечивает формировать автономные контексты для разных заказчиков. Серверные казино вавада предоставляют гибкость и эффективность облачных сервисов.
Научные вычисления запрашивают мощных серверных кластеров для осуществления больших массивов сведений. Научные организации симулируют многоуровневые явления. Медицинские заведения хранят компьютерные досье клиентов на охраняемых машинах. Образовательные порталы обеспечивают доступ к учебным данным.